本专利介绍了一种自调式低温G—M循环制冷机。该机在排出器与制冷剂流动的新颖控制方法颇具特色。排出器及与阀门配合作用的可动滑阀,用来控制制冷剂进、出工作腔的流动,从而不用电机驱动。该工作腔的容积随排出器的运动而改变。本发明讨论了在很低温度下(110~14K)制冷时所使用的改进方法及其设备。
This patent describes a self-regulating cryogenic G-M circulating refrigerator. The machine is unique in its innovative control of the flow of displacer and refrigerant. The ejector and the movable slide valve cooperating with the valve are used to control the flow of the refrigerant into and out of the working chamber so as not to be driven by the motor. The volume of the working chamber changes with the movement of the ejector. The present invention discusses an improved method and apparatus for cooling at very low temperatures (110-14K).
